Transaction 8fef589ec449bd30915d3e4b8031e9133a60c6710926d294b23b0f1d75f8ed51
1 Input
1 Output
-
8fef589ec449bd30915d3e4b8031e9133a60c6710926d294b23b0f1d75f8ed51:0
- value
- 159182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c16aabd2667ce38e64942557181ba342e55e99a OP_EQUAL
- address
- 3D18sFuwG3m49voSHoHJnxagX3f7vFkjNc